Right Side Capital Management

Right Side Capital Management is a San Francisco-based venture capital firm that focuses on early-stage, pre-seed technology startups in underserved segments of the ecosystem. It invests in a high-volume, capital-efficient portfolio, typically funding rounds of 50,000 to 500,000 and making roughly 75 to 100 investments per year. The firm targets opportunities across the United States and internationally, including Canada, Israel, Australia, New Zealand, and Western Europe, prioritizing companies with scalable products and prudent capital use outside major metro hubs. Since its inception, it has built a broad portfolio across many states. It commits to a fast decision process, often delivering a yes or no within two weeks to help founders establish momentum.

TypingDNA

Seed Round in 2018
TypingDNA, Inc. is a technology company that specializes in typing biometrics authentication solutions. Founded in 2016 and headquartered in Brooklyn, New York, with additional offices in Oradea and Bucharest, Romania, TypingDNA offers an innovative service that enables organizations to authenticate users based on their unique typing patterns. This technology compares current keystrokes with previously recorded typing behaviors, allowing for secure logins, password resets, and multi-factor authentication. The company's solutions are particularly beneficial for the financial services and education sectors, where they enhance security and combat fraud while maintaining a seamless user experience. By employing artificial intelligence algorithms, TypingDNA provides a more effective alternative to traditional two-factor authentication methods, enabling clients to better protect sensitive information without sacrificing usability.

GetAFive

Seed Round in 2012
GetAFive is an online platform designed to assist students in preparing for AP tests and regular exams in AP courses. Founded in 2012 by Lindsay Cohen and Danny Levi, the platform provides a range of resources, including video reviews from expert teachers, customized study plans, diagnostic tests, and practice exams. Upon purchasing an AP class review, students begin with a diagnostic test to identify their areas for improvement. They then access individual video lessons, each accompanied by a review quiz and study notes. Additionally, GetAFive allows students to take practice exams and offers the option for their free response questions to be hand-graded by AP teachers. Parents can also create accounts to purchase classes for their children and monitor their progress through the platform. GetAFive aims to enhance students' preparation and confidence leading up to their exams.
